Meeting notes — Operations sync, item 4

Uniform order for the new Crestley depot was approved. Forty sets from Merrow Workwear, sized per the staff roster. Delivery expected next Tuesday; Office Manager to arrange internal distribution and record sign-outs. Boxes will move by courier from the Aldgrove hub, with the hand-over instruction noted below.

handover note for yagef-bagep: the drudor pelius courier leaves the kasdor zorvan norir ledger at gate 8016 under passcode 755406

Subject: Loaned exhibition pieces — return shipment Wednesday

Dear Dispatch Desk,

The four framed textile pieces on loan from the Quillbrook Gallery are due back this week under our loan agreement. They are packed in padded cases in the second-floor store, signed off by the office manager this morning. Please schedule a single-driver run for Wednesday, climate-neutral van preferred, and confirm the slot with me by end of day. The courier hand-over instruction follows below.

dispatch memo: the lamwyn fenwyn courier leaves the wenir ledger at gate 7175 under passcode 822969

## Onboarding: Fareweight Rules Engine

Fareweight computes shipping fees from stacked rule sets. Rules are versioned; never edit a live version. Deploys go through the staging evaluator first. Read the rule DSL guide before touching anything.

Rule definitions live in the pricing database — connect to it with the connection string below.

primary connection of yagep-bajop = postgresql://druiel_svc:gW@db-3860.sivrelworks.example:5432/brieth

Ticket: Bad encoding detection on uploaded .txt files

Project Ferncast mislabels Windows-1252 uploads as UTF-8, mangling smart quotes. Detection lib only samples the first 1KB; files with ASCII-only headers slip through. Fix: sample 8KB, fall back to byte-frequency heuristic, reject if confidence <0.7 and prompt the user. Don't touch the CSV path — that's handled by Ingestor separately. Repro files are attached to the ticket. The build to verify against is noted below.

build token for tawip-yageg: htk9_92ac43d42